Hadith: Who are those family members, love of which obligated upon us?

It was narrated by Tabarani in al-Kabir, Qatiy in zawaid to Fadail sahaba (1141)

Harb ibn all-Hasan at-Tahhan Hussain al-Ashqar Qays (ibn Rabia) Al-Amash from Said ibn Jubair ibn Abbas: When it was revealed verse No reward do I ask of you for this except the love of those near of kin (42/23), people asked: O messenger of Allah, who are those from your close family members, whose love became incumbent upon us? He answered: Ali, Fatima, and their sons (alaihuma salam). (cited from Fadail) *

This hadith isn't authentic.
First of all it contradicts to authentic agreed upon narration from ibn Abbas.( http://kawakib.wapgroups.com/topic.asp?tid=134031 See This Article)

Second it contradicts to known history facts. Ali and Fatima (may Allah be pleased with them) married after hijra, and this verse was revealed in Mecca, as said ibn Kathir.

Thirdly this chain is extremely weak. Suyuti noticed its weakness in his commentary

1) Harb ibn al-Hasan was weak. See ''Majmau zawaid'' No. 14747
2) Hussain al-Ashqar weak. He was criticized by Bukhari, Abu Zurah, Abu Hatim, Nasai and Daraqutni. (''Mizanul itidal'' 1/531/No. 1986)
3) Qays ibn Rabia was weak. He was discredited by Nasai, Daraqutni, Ahmad and ibn Maeen. (Mizanul itidal 3/393/No. 6910)
4) Al-Amash Sulaiman ibn Mihran was thiqat, but known mudalis, and he narrated this in anana form.
Shaikh Albani said this narration is false in ''Silsila ad-daefa'' (4974) *
